NAME

       xfs_info - display XFS filesystem geometry information

SYNOPSIS

       xfs_info [ -t mtab ] [ mount-point | block-device | file-image ]
       xfs_info -V

DESCRIPTION

       xfs_info displays geometry information about an existing XFS filesystem.  The mount-point argument is the
       pathname  of  a  directory where the filesystem is mounted.  The block-device or file-image contain a raw
       XFS filesystem.  The existing contents of the filesystem are undisturbed.

OPTIONS

       -t     Specifies an alternate mount table file (default is /proc/mounts if it  exists,  else  /etc/mtab).
              This  is  used  when working with filesystems mounted without writing to /etc/mtab file - refer to
              mount(8) for further details.  This option has no  effect  with  the  block-device  or  file-image
              parameters.

       -V     Prints the version number and exits. The mount-point argument is not required with -V.

EXAMPLES

       Understanding xfs_info output.

       Suppose one has the following "xfs_info /dev/sda" output:

         meta-data=/dev/pmem0             isize=512    agcount=8, agsize=5974144 blks
                  =                       sectsz=512   attr=2, projid32bit=1
                  =                       crc=1        finobt=1, sparse=1, rmapbt=1
                  =                       reflink=1
         data     =                       bsize=4096   blocks=47793152, imaxpct=25
                  =                       sunit=32     swidth=128 blks
         naming   =version 2              bsize=4096   ascii-ci=0, ftype=1
         log      =internal log           bsize=4096   blocks=23336, version=2
                  =                       sectsz=512   sunit=0 blks, lazy-count=1
         realtime =none                   extsz=4096   blocks=0, rtextents=0

       Here,  the  data  section  of  the  output  indicates  "bsize=4096", meaning the data block size for this
       filesystem is 4096 bytes.  This section also shows "sunit=32 swidth=128 blks",  which  means  the  stripe
       unit  is  32*4096 bytes = 128 kibibytes and the stripe width is 128*4096 bytes = 512 kibibytes.  A single
       stripe of this filesystem therefore consists of four stripe units (128 blocks / 32 blocks per unit).
